You will point to the letters that make that sound.” a i o u e O U I A E Kindergarten – Unit 5 – Pre-Assessment – Student 4 Comprehension Student Prompt: “I will read a story to you.” How the Firefly Got Its Light (Adapted from www.teacher.depaul.edu ) This is a story about long ago. There was a little fly. It wanted to be special. The fly was sad. It did not feel special. It looked at the bee and thought it was great. “Look how big it is. Hear it buzz.” It looked at the butterfly and said, “See how pretty. Look at the colors. Look at its big wings. But I am just like all the other flies.” The fly stayed awake one night. It was worried. It was sad. All the other flies were sleeping. A moth was awake. So was a mouse. They did not notice the fly. It was too small. It was hard to see in the dark. The fly saw the stars. They were shining. “I want to shine like that. That would be special.” The moon heard the fly. The moon said, “Little fly. You can help me. If you do, I will help you. I will make you shine.” “How can I help?” The moon said, “You can be my friend. I am lonely at night. I come out when it is dark. Most animals are asleep. If you stay awake every night I will help you shine. You can be my friend.” “Yes, yes,” the fly said. “I will stay awake every night. I would love to be your friend.” The next night, the fly stayed awake. And the next night…and the next night...and the next night… The moon became friends with fly. So the moon told fly the secret of how to shine. Fly used the secret. It worked! Fly was shining. Fly could make its body shine on and off. It looked like magic. The fly was very glad. The fly told the moon, “I will always be your friend. When you come out at night, I will be here. I will shine my light to welcome you.” As the fly went to sleep he thought, “Finally, now I’m special too.” Fly not only had something special. He also had a friend. Kindergarten – Unit 5 – Pre-Assessment – Student 6 Penguins (Adapted from www.teacher.depaul.edu) The penguin is a bird, but it does not fly. Penguins are not like other birds. They are unique or different birds. Although they do have feathers, even their feathers are unique. A penguin’s feathers grow all over, like hair on an animal. The feathers make the penguin look like he has on clothes like a tuxedo. Do these penguins look like they have on a tuxedo? You will not see penguins in the air, and you will not see them in trees. Penguins like to spend most of their time in the water. They are strong swimmers. Penguins get their food from the water. But they do not have any teeth. They just swallow their food without chewing. List 1 List 2 List 3 List 4 List 5 List 6 List 7 List 8 List 9 List 10 I red have is you little first came could eight see blue like play this and why when day then a yellow can come want what there away look her the green we on but too jump where who at orange am be off two not get six your my purple in big run love that ten three because go brown of one she his him four they out it black us has here all got went with from no pink was are saw said up he five eat yes white to for do new me as seven nine /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 /10 so Kindergarten – Unit 5 – Pre-Assessment – Student 9 Phonemic Awareness - Segmenting Phonemes in Words Student Prompt: “I am going to tell you a word. You are going to say the sounds in the word. For example, if I say ‘mom’, you would say, /m/ /o/ /m/.” If the student responds differently, ask them to listen again. “‘Sat’ has the sounds /s/ /a/ /t/. Now you tell me the sounds in ‘sat’.” Continue with assessment if child responds correctly or incorrectly. Say the stimulus and pause 4 seconds for a response each time you give the word. Consider response as incorrect if student does not respond in 4 seconds or replies with a different response. (RF.K.2d) DOK 1 Indicate YES for a correct response and NO for an incorrect response in the box to the right of the word on the form below.
